On 12/13/2011 12:33 PM, Tom Rini wrote:
> So, we have various characteristics of the NAND chip that need to be
> described for SPL.  Today we do CONFIG_SYS_NAND... but they're
> unchanged in every implementation and are calculated from other
> per-board values.  So to avoid duplication in each config file, we
> drop them from there and use them only locally #define calculate them
> in the file that needs them.  Since they're still system specific
> values, I had suggested calling them SYS_... but I wasn't sure what
> the right namespace is.  I had a recollection that using CONFIG_
> outside of config files was a bad idea.

These symbols are not in a header file -- how about just plain ECCSTEPS
and ECCTOTAL?
